I realised I have Sooo... many of the Barry M nail paints. I think this is because they are such good value for money selling at around £3.99 each, I believe they are just as good if not better then some of the more expensive nail paints out there. Barry M also sell such a wide variety of colours if you are searching for a pink nail varnish define pink! Barry M must have about a dozen maybe even more different shades of pink so it is hard not to want to collect and try them all.
I find Barry M nail paints to be kind off a hit-and-miss sometimes, the majority of the time the formulas are very easy to apply and have a professional finish, my friends have sometimes mistaken my nail varnish for shellac because it looks so nice. Unfortunately I have purchased a few that have been gooey and not as easy to apply I find that this is mostly in the darker shades within the gelly nail paint range. Overall I do love Barry M nail paints and I find all the colours listed in this blog post to be easy to apply and they all have a lovely finish to them! :)
If you are a lover of the Barry M nail paints like me then the Gelly high shine nail paints are an absolute must! The polish's claim to give you an "extra glossy finish" and I 100% agree that they do just that. I have had so many compliments from wearing these nail polish's they really do make my nails look like they have been done in a salon! The pastels in particular apply easily to my nails with absolutely no streaks! They are also so pigmented! I prefer to coat my nails twice with the polish however you could defiantly achieve a professional look with just one coat!
The Barry M silk nail paint also gives a lovely effect with a soft matte finish but still a lovely slight shimmer. Contrasting to the gelly nail paint the formula seems to be quite thin so I would recommend building up coats until achieving the perfect look. The quality of these nail polish's is amazing and although giving off a slight frosty finish I believe these colours would look so nice during the spring.
